Meaning and Origin
Ayeisa is a name of Arabic origin, derived from the name 'A'ishah. 'A'ishah, meaning "alive" or "she who lives," is a significant name in Islamic culture, borne by the revered third wife of the Prophet Muhammad, 'Āʾisha bint Abī Bakr. This association gives Ayeisa a rich historical and religious context, connecting it to a powerful and respected figure. While 'A'ishah remains more prevalent in Arabic-speaking regions, Ayeisa has emerged as a more modern variation gaining traction in the English-speaking world.
Pronunciation and Spelling
Ayeisa is pronounced "eye-ee-sa," with the emphasis on the first syllable. Its unique spelling, with the "y" replacing the usual "i" in "Aisha," adds a touch of distinction and might be slightly challenging for some to decipher initially. However, its sound is straightforward and easy to grasp once you hear it. The unusual spelling could lead to occasional mispronunciation or spelling mistakes, but it also lends the name a sense of individuality.

Nickname Choices
While Ayeisa itself is a complete name, it lends itself to a few charming nicknames. "Aie" or "Isa" are natural shortenings, offering a casual and familiar feel. "Aya" is another option, drawing from the name's Arabic origins and offering a slightly more sophisticated sound. The choice of nickname can reflect personal preference and the individual's relationship with the name.
